General Features:
- In-dash CD, MP3, WMA Receiver with remote and front aux input
- Detachable face
- Dot matrix with variable 4096 colors display
- Wireless remote control included
- Red button lighting
- Power Output:
- Peak: 50 watts x 4 channels
- RMS: 18 watts x 4 channels
- CD Text Display
- WMA and MP3 ID3 Tag Display (Title/Artist/Album)

Playback and Audio Features:
- Playback of CD, CD-R, CD-RW, MP3, and WMA
- Tuner with 15FM/5AM presets
- Source specific sound adjustment
- 3-Band Equalizer with 3 EQ presets
- X-Bass
- Sub-out (variable gain, frequency)
- BBE MP Digital Sound processing to enhance your MP3/WMA playback
Expandability Options:
- 2 Sets of 2V preamp outputs (front and rear)
- Bluetooth Ready: Blaupunkt 7607545500 Bluetooth module required and sold separately
- iPod Ready: Blaupunkt iPod Interface adapter required and sold separately
- The Apple iPhone 3G, iPod Nano 4th Gen, iPod Touch 2nd Gen, and any other newly released iPods can be controlled using the iPod adapter above; however, charging will not be possible unless you purchase the Scosche IFWA PassPORT charging adapter.
- Front-panel auxiliary input: 3.5mm (headphone jack) allows connection to portable media devices such as MP3 players, etc.
- USB Ready: Blaupunkt 7607545500 Bluetooth/USB module required and sold separately
- CD Changer controls

Bought this for my mom, very sleek looking player. Has a RCA sub-out and also front/rear outs. Sub-out can act as a rear channel if wanted, the only thing, its subject to electrical noise, because if the amp is receiving the sub out signal, and you change settings, u'll hear a little pop. No big deal. Unit has a ton of features, 3 band eq with 4 priority frequencies for each band. Sub out has a 160, 100, 80, 60 cut off. I cut it off at 160 and hooked up 6x9 to it, so i get better sound imaging in the front. Very good unit, Deff recommend. German quality. Awesome
